President-General of Ohanaeze Ndigbo dies

Share
Share

The President General of the apex Igbo socio-political organisation, Ohanaeze Ndigbo, Professor George Obiozor.

The Governor of Imo State, Hope Uzodimma disclosed in a statement on his Instagram page on Wednesday night.

Uzodimma said, “On behalf of the Government and people of Imo State, I, Senator Hope Uzodimma, the Executive Governor of Imo State, sorrowfully announce the passage of a great Son of Imo State and Nigeria, the President General of Ohanaeze Ndigbo, worldwide, Prof George OBIOZOR.

“A renowned academic, an exceptional diplomat, a statesman and a tenacious patriot, Prof George Obiozor passed on recently after a brief illness.

“The death of this foremost Igbo leader and former NIGERIA’S ambassador to the United States and the State of Israel, is a big loss to Imo State, the South East and the entire Nigeria.

“I have no doubt that both Nigeria and the international community will miss his profound intellectual contributions and wise counsel on national and global issues.

“His burial arrangements will be announced in due course by the family

May his great and gentle soul rest in peace.”

Early on Wednesday, there had been speculations on the death of the elder statesman.
